The Rise of Padel Tennis


To understand the market dynamics of padel tennis, it’s essential to acknowledge its rapid growth. Originating in Mexico in the 1960s, padel has made its way to Europe, particularly Spain and Sweden, becoming a national pastime. More recently, countries in Asia and the Americas have also embraced the sport. With its unique blend of tennis and squash, padel is played on a smaller court enclosed with glass walls, making it accessible and enjoyable for everyone.


Factors Influencing Pricing


Several factors contribute to the pricing of padel tennis equipment and facilities


1. Quality of Equipment The materials and technology used in padel rackets, balls, and court construction significantly impact their prices. High-quality rackets made with advanced materials like carbon fiber tend to be more expensive but offer better performance and durability. Similarly, courts constructed with premium materials will also command higher prices.


2. Brand Reputation Established brands often charge more for their products due to their reputation and perceived quality. Brands like Bullpadel, Asics, and Wilson have developed a loyal customer base that values their products' reliability. Emerging brands may offer competitive pricing to attract new customers, making it essential for buyers to compare options.


3. Supply and Demand As the popularity of padel tennis rises, so does the demand for equipment. Suppliers adjust prices based on market demand; in high-demand regions, prices may increase substantially. Conversely, suppliers may offer promotions or discounts in regions where the sport is still growing.


4. Customization and Personalization Some players seek customized rackets or gear that suit their specific playing style. Personalized products often come at a premium price, as they require additional resources for production.


5. Location and Distribution The geographical location of suppliers also affects pricing. Import costs, taxes, and tariffs can raise prices for players in certain regions. Local suppliers may offer more competitive pricing due to lower shipping costs.

Suppliers play a crucial role in the padel tennis market by connecting manufacturers with consumers. They ensure that training facilities, clubs, and individual players have access to the latest equipment. Understanding the difference between various suppliers can aid consumers in making informed choices.


1. Direct Manufacturers Some companies sell directly to consumers, often at more competitive prices without the added overhead of intermediaries. This model is growing in popularity, especially online.


2. Distributors and Retailers Traditional retailers and distributors may offer a broader range of brands and products but could have higher prices due to their operating costs. However, they can provide valuable customer support and product expertise.


3. Online Platforms E-commerce has revolutionized the way players purchase padel tennis equipment. Websites dedicated to sports gear often feature various brands and prices, allowing buyers to compare and find better deals. Additionally, online sales are not limited by geography, enabling broader accessibility.


Finding the Best Deals


To maximize value when purchasing padel tennis equipment, here are some tips for players and clubs


- Research Compare prices from different suppliers, both online and offline. Signing up for newsletters can provide access to exclusive discounts.


- Buy in Bulk For clubs, purchasing equipment in larger quantities often yields discounts.


- Keep an Eye on Sales Seasonal sales and clearance events can be excellent opportunities to find high-quality equipment at lower prices.


- Join Padel Communities Engaging with fellow players and clubs can lead to group-buying opportunities or recommendations for trusted suppliers offering competitive pricing.
